Roof hooks play a crucial role in the installation and stability of photovoltaic (PV) mounting systems, especially in the industrial equipment and components sector. These small yet essential components provide a secure connection between the solar panels and the roof structure, ensuring the longevity and efficiency of the PV system.
One of the key technical aspects of roof hooks is their design and material composition. Typically made from high-grade stainless steel or aluminum, roof hooks are engineered to withstand harsh weather conditions, UV exposure, and mechanical stress. This durability is essential for ensuring the long-term performance of the PV system and the safety of the installation.
In addition to their durability, roof hooks are designed to be versatile and easy to install. With adjustable angles and heights, roof hooks can accommodate various roof types and configurations, making them suitable for a wide range of installation scenarios. This flexibility allows for optimal positioning of the solar panels to maximize sunlight exposure and energy generation.
Furthermore, the design of roof hooks also plays a role in the overall aesthetics of the PV system. By securely attaching the solar panels to the roof without compromising its structural integrity, roof hooks contribute to a clean and streamlined appearance. This not only enhances the visual appeal of the installation but also minimizes the risk of damage or dislodgment over time.
Overall, roof hooks are a fundamental component in the successful deployment of photovoltaic mounting systems in the industrial equipment and components sector. Their technical features, including durability, versatility, and aesthetic appeal, make them essential for ensuring the efficiency and reliability of solar energy generation. By understanding the importance of roof hooks, businesses can make informed decisions when selecting and installing PV systems for their operations.
